Serving 397 students in grades 6-12, Young Men's Leadership Academy 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Texas for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 35% (which is lower than the Texas state average of 41%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 51% (which is equal to the Texas state average of 51%).
The student:teacher ratio of 10:1 is lower than the Texas state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 95%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Black), which is higher than the Texas state average of 75% (majority Hispanic).

Young Men's Leadership Academy's student population of 397 students has grown by 8% over five school years.
The teacher population of 38 teachers has declined by 11% over five school years.

Young Men's Leadership Academy ranks within the bottom 50% of all 8,188 schools in Texas (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data).
The diversity score of Young Men's Leadership Academy is 0.61, which is less than the diversity score at state average of 0.64. The school's diversity has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
